GOLO RECIPES BLOG

GOLO’s customer-only gated website houses the recipes blog as a helpful weight loss journey tool to create balanced, nutritional and healthy meals while taking GOLO supplements

CHALLENGE 

Redesign entire “GOLO recipes” blog due to the following pain points:

  • Users have difficulty finding where to search for recipes, ingredients etc

  • Too much scrolling; everything is large

  • Category dropdown list is too long and not user friendly

  • On the individual recipe post, users have trouble finding where to print the recipe

  • Printed recipes are too light and difficult  to read

  • Print recipe screen gives no selection options to change font size or to include or not include images

NEW PRINT RECIPE PAGE

Full recipe post is displayed with user friendly printing options

  • All recipes automatically print in black and white

  • Recipe can be printed fully as it is presented

  • Print recipe and print option buttons are easily accessible on top of page

After print options button is selected, user can select print choices

  • Images can be included or removed

  • Description can be included or removed

  • Text size selections are small or large type

  • As stated before, recipes automatically print in black and white making them very legible

RESULTS

Designed a user friendly recipe blog that will help GOLO customers in their weight loss journey

Entire blog is built with editable CMS components that will allow for changes to go live faster.

CMS components can be used universally on GOLO’s regular main blog.

Created an improved recipe search experience.

Develped advanced search.

Featured recipes categories are easy to find.

Significantly reduced scrolling.

Added breadcrumb navigation.

Designed a clickable category directory eliminating the long dropdown that was an issue in the old design. Directory allows recipes to be listed by meal type, course, diet, season, method, ingredient, and by series.

Introduced “Most Recent” subcategory recipe blog post feed.

Recipes can now be added to or removed from favorite’s list.

Recipe post offers many options.

Print recipe button is easy to find.

Print recipe page provides image, description and text size options. All recipes automatically print in black and white so that they are legible for people of all ages.
